Baylor Jack and Jane Hamilton Heart and Vascular Hospital
Location: Dallas
Type of company: Hospital/health system
Meet the organization: BHVH opened in 2002 as the first joint venture hospital of Baylor Health Care System. The 64-bed hospital is Magnet-designated for nursing excellence and has a staff retention rate of more than 95 percent. Its quarterly employee survey encourages candidness with a “Stupid List,” which asks employees to tell leadership what is ineffective around the organization and has resulted in improvements to employee and patient satisfaction.
Added benefits: The hospital offers individual talent development plans and up to $5,250 in tuition reimbursement for healthcare-related courses. Its Baylor Beneplace program also gives employees discounts on child care, wireless plans, theme parks, movie tickets, home insurance and more.
